Leitner Pro-tips:::

1 wk to resumption. As we are resuming,here are random tips I thought I should share-

1) Registration is always stressful. Exceptions are faculties with low number of students {dentistry,clinical sciences,Pharmacy,Law,Basic medical}; the remaining faculties have high number of students.
If you are in one of the faculties with many student,the trick is- just be a little bit patient. Don't rush to do your reg immediately you resume as people are always much;therefore making the process stressful. During my time,after stressfully waiting 7:00 - 4:00 for like 4 days without any success with my reg,in anger,I decided not to go again. I eventually completed my reg later when lecture has started,in less than 15 mins of waiting.

2) Academics- one thing you should make sure of in your academic life is that- your notes should always be complete. Make sure your notes are complete,and if you are the lazy type like me,you can always photocopy{Find and make friends with someone who attends class regularly}. Reading only textbooks will never make you ace exams. For part 1 students, most of your exams and tests will be set from your notes. And most lecturers only mark answers correct when you put them word for word as it is in the note. Textbooks are good for supplementary,but your notes are the MAIN THING!.

Another one{this is for those live in hostels apart from Moz and Angola}- The main advantage of being a Fresher in Ang and Moz is that you easily get the latest information,also on time and it is vice versa for those that don't stay in Ang and Moz.
That's why I will advice you guyz to always keep contacts with your course mates; it's very necessary. Make sure you have the class rep's number. There is also always a departmental group on whatsapp,make sure you join that too or you might just miss the practical that has been re-fixed to an earlier date. The whatsapp group might be annoying @ first due to barrage of notifications you will be receiving and the nonsense chats going on there. But believe me,it will definitely come in handy Later.

Lastly on academics- it's a cliche but here it is:: make sure you start reading as early as possible. Time flies so fast that before you know it,notes are already becoming bulky,test has already started and small time again,you are already preparing for exams. So,unless you are einstein or like crash-reading,which is a gamble,I will implore you to start reading couple weeks into resumption and before your notes start getting bulky and voluminous.
